Medical Treatment

It is essential to seek medical care as soon as you are injured in a car crash. This will help prevent further injury or illness from arising.

The sooner you receive medical treatment for your injuries, the better you will be in proving your claim to compensation. It will be easier to prove that the injury you suffered was directly related to the car accident lawyers near me crash, and also that it required treatment.

Although minor aches, pains, numbness, or swelling may not seem serious, they can quickly become more severe and life-threatening if not treated promptly. Moreover, insurance adjusters and defense lawyers often try to use your failure to seek medical attention as an excuse for not agreeing with your claim for compensation.

Damages

In the event of a car accident, you could be entitled to various types of damages. They can include both economic and non-economic damages.

Economic damage refers to the financial losses that you've suffered, including medical bills and lost wages. These damages are determined by the extent of your injuries.

Noneconomic damages, such as emotional trauma, as well as loss of quality of life, can also be claimed. These are the kind of damages that can have a significant impact on your life and the pleasure you experience from it.
